Web16 Dec 2024 · What is a Tenor? A Tenor has a high-pitched voice that falls between the Baritone and Alto voice types. The word comes from the old French medieval Latin word tenere, which means to hold. This is because the Tenor, being above the other male-associated voicetypes, often held the melody. Webtenor (Latin) Origin & history From teneō ("hold"). Noun tenor (genitive tenōris) (masc.) a holding on, continuance, course, career, duration; a holder; Descendants.
